Transaction 3e6587d3794b113951db2778ac5ff85856653a2db3b879e96c1899e00aec5b99
1 Input
1 Output
-
3e6587d3794b113951db2778ac5ff85856653a2db3b879e96c1899e00aec5b99:0
- value
- 23413414
- script pubkey
- OP_0 OP_PUSHBYTES_20 9dfbd1fa12aea5c2f153d4e32b0e0d7e54d1f51a
- address
- bc1qnhaar7sj46ju9u2n6n3jkrsd0e2drag6mh4hv6